A PhD student uncovers dark secrets in this 'richly atmospheric and irresistibly readable' (Joyce Carol Oates) mystery set in Scotland, Italy, and France. For fans of Donna Tartt and Elizabeth Kostova.

Fleeing a disastrous love affair, Isabel Henley leaves the US to begin a PhD in Scotland. There she reconnects with the charismatic Rose Brewster, a former classmate, who becomes a much-needed friend. When Rose reveals she’s in trouble, Isabel decides to help her.

Then Rose vanishes.

No clues can be found until Isabel receives a coded message: Rose is alive, but held captive by people who don’t want her to complete her historical research. Isabel realises she must finish Rose’s work if she wants to save her life.

The trail leads Isabel to the great cities of Italy and France. She must decipher a chain of betrayal and treason lasting centuries, and solve a 400-year-old mystery... or risk being claimed by it too.

For fans of The Cloisters, The Secret History and The Maidens, this is a gripping literary thriller set in the world of dark academia.

Joanna Margaret is an art historian whose previous writing and scholarly work has focused on Florentine aristocrats in sixteenth-century France. She holds a PhD from the University of St Andrews and an MFA from NYU, where Joyce Carol Oates served as her thesis advisor. The Bequest is her first novel.
